Runbook: Murmurgate alert deduplicator. When duplicate pages leak through, first verify the fingerprint window in dedupe.yaml is 300 seconds and that the hash includes alert source and severity, not timestamps. Restart only the coalescer pod, never the ingest pod, or in-flight alerts will be dropped. After restart, replay the last hour of alerts from the Echobin queue to confirm suppression works. The replay tool authenticates against the internal Echobin API with the key below.

service key, fawip-bajef: kto11_Qt5wZK9vdNC

## Runbook: Read-replica lag alarm (Driftmere DB)

Alarm fires when replica lag on the Driftmere cluster exceeds threshold for five minutes. First: check whether a bulk import is running; those are expected and can be ack'd. Otherwise, confirm replication threads are alive and look for long-running queries pinning the replay position. Do not promote a replica without paging the database lead. Contractors: never edit settings on the host directly. The thresholds and replication settings currently in effect are listed below.

config for haweg-bagag:
[kasath]
host = kasath.qirvancorp.internal
user = kasath_svc
database = kasath_prod

/*
 * Client setup for Strandweb, our dependency graph visualizer.
 * This client fetches graph layouts from the internal Strandweb
 * render service, not the public mirror — the public mirror lags
 * by hours and lacks private module edges. Timeouts are set high
 * because large graphs can take minutes to render. Authentication
 * for the render service uses the key provided below.
 */

service key, kaduf-bawig: kto15_Ze79S0dligTw0yO

TICKET-4471: Pixelbarn image cache leaking memory under burst load. Heap grows ~200MB/hr; evictions stop after the Thumbor-lite sidecar restarts. Root cause suspected: the cache warmer's credentials to the Glacierhaus metadata service expired last Tuesday, so lookups fail and entries are never marked evictable. Rotate the key, restart pixelbarn-cache-02 through 05, and confirm RSS flattens within 30 min. Escalate to Maret on the Quillfox team if it doesn't. New key for the Glacierhaus metadata service is below.

gateway credential: kto3_qfe